Greater Vancouver REALTORS Market Report: June 2026 Shows 7.6% Year-Over-Year Price Decline
Greater Vancouver REALTORS (HPI) — June 2026
In June 2026, the composite benchmark price for Greater Vancouver real estate is $1,890,000, reflecting a 7.6% decrease from $2,046,100 in June 2025. The market currently exhibits balanced conditions, with no sales or listing data available for this month.
Market Analysis
The Greater Vancouver real estate market continues to demonstrate balanced conditions as of June 2026, with the composite benchmark price declining from $1,907,000 in May 2026 to $1,890,000 this month. This marks a significant year-over-year decrease of 7.6%, indicating a cooling trend in the market. Although specific sales and listing data are not available for June, the overall trend suggests that buyers are becoming more cautious, potentially due to rising interest rates and economic uncertainties.
Property Type Analysis
In terms of property types, the detached homes have a benchmark price of $2,062,300, while attached/townhouses are priced at $1,199,300. The absence of sales data for both categories makes it challenging to assess their performance in the current market; however, the significant price points indicate that detached homes remain a premium option, while townhouses may attract a broader range of buyers seeking affordability.
